Hi Henk57:

Thanks for the reply. The challenge is that the questionnaire is
distributed to respondents and so it is much more convenient to have it
contained in a single file. Trying to do it this way is also imposed by a
constraint to have the hardcopy look identical to the "electronic" copy that
respondents willl complete.

What I have come to learn is that when the link to the embedded spreadsheet
object is first created, the field (displayed with Alt F9) has the corrrect
path & filename for the Word doc. For example:

{Link Excel.Sheet.8 "c:\\test questionnaire.doc"
"_1242205181!Sheet1!R1C1:R3C3" \a \p }

The first time the link is selected and you right click to open the link,
the speadsheet opens but upon returning to the Word document, the field
changes from the actual file name to:

{Link Excel.Sheet.8 "Worksheet in test questionnaire.doc" Sheet1!R1C1:R3C3"
\a \p }

When you then try to open this linked object again, Word says the the
filename is invalid or the link is corrupt.

I have tried to replace the file name with the "filename \p" field, but Word
overwrites this as well.

Any suggestions???
